Sumitomo Mitsui Trust Group Inc. Has $404.44 Million Position in Comcast Corporation (NASDAQ:CMCSA)

Comcast logo with Consumer Discretionary background

Sumitomo Mitsui Trust Group Inc. boosted its position in shares of Comcast Corporation (NASDAQ:CMCSA - Free Report) by 1.3%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 10,960,493 shares of the cable giant's stock after buying an additional 140,062 shares during the quarter. Sumitomo Mitsui Trust Group Inc. owned approximately 0.29% of Comcast worth $404,442,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Comcast Trading Up 0.3%

CMCSA opened at $35.32 on Friday. Comcast Corporation has a twelve month low of $31.44 and a twelve month high of $45.31. The company has a 50-day simple moving average of $34.61 and a 200 day simple moving average of $35.64. The company has a quick ratio of 0.65, a current ratio of 0.65 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.06. The stock has a market capitalization of $131.87 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 8.68, a P/E/G ratio of 1.70 and a beta of 0.95.

Comcast (NASDAQ:CMCSA -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, April 24th. The cable giant reported $1.09 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.01 by $0.08. The firm had revenue of $29.89 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$29.82 billion. Comcast had a return on equity of 19.70% and a net margin of 12.72%. The business's quarterly revenue was down .6%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$1.04 earnings per share. Analysts predict that Comcast Corporation will post 4.33 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Comcast Dividend Announcement

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, July 23rd.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, July 2nd will be paid a $0.33 dividend. This represents a $1.32 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.74%.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, July 2nd. Comcast's dividend payout ratio is currently 32.43%.

Comcast Company Profile

(Free Report)

Comcast Corporation operates as a media and technology company worldwide. It operates through Residential Connectivity & Platforms, Business Services Connectivity, Media, Studios, and Theme Parks segments. The Residential Connectivity & Platforms segment provides residential broadband and wireless connectivity services, residential and business video services, sky-branded entertainment television networks, and advertising.
